The Indiana Players are pleased to help support the next generation of artists and active community members by sponsoring the Frances Stineman Scholarship.

A scholarship of $1,000 will be awarded to a deserving, college bound high school senior or junior who has been a contributing member of Indiana Players and the Philadelphia Street Playhouse.

Deadline for application is:

March 31st, 2023​

​​

Qualifications

  • The student must have volunteered a significant number of community service to the Indiana Players and contributed to our community playhouse. 

  • The student must be accepted into a college, community college, or trade school. It does not require the major to be in the theater arts.

  • The student must have a record of good academic performance as well as extracurricular and community activities outside of the Indiana Players. 

  • The student must have a need for financial assistance in paying for college, community college, or trade school. 

 

Applicants must submit the following:

  •  A letter of interest containing a personal statement as to their strengths as a candidate.

  •  A  resume highlighting both performance and technical theater experience.

  • Two letters of recommendation

    • Letters should be from a high school teacher, theater director, community leader, etc.

    • One letter must be from a member of the Indiana Players.
